.NOTE
(see electrical characteristics sheet)
1.
Initial supply voltage (VSI) is the supply voltage required to start the tone ringer oscillating.
2.
Sustaining voltage (Vsus) is the supply voltage required to maintain oscillation.
3.
VTR and ITR are the conditions applied to trigger in to start oscillation for VSUS≤ Vcc ≤VsI
4.
VDIS and IDIS are the conditions applied to trigger in to inhibit oscillation for VSI ≤Vcc
5.
Trigger current must be limited to this value externally.
